1. Establishing a Fail-Safe Tech Stack: Smart Access & Security

In Westlands, guests expect a premium, hotel-like check-in experience. Manual key handovers via caretakers or security guards are outdated, prone to security breaches, and cause unnecessary friction. Implementing a modern smart access system is the first and most critical step in remote property management.

The Power of a Smart Lock in Westlands Apartments

Installing a high-quality smart lock airbnb westlands is non-negotiable. Because Westlands is dominated by high-rise apartment complexes, your lock must integrate seamlessly with building-wide security protocols while offering you full remote control.

When selecting a smart lock, look for these features:
* Multiple Access Modes: The lock should support PIN codes, fingerprint recognition, RFID cards, and physical key overrides.
* TTLock or Tuya App Integration: These platforms allow you to generate unique, time-bound access codes from your smartphone anywhere in the world. When a guest books for three nights, their code is programmed to activate at 3:00 PM on check-in day and automatically expire at 11:00 AM on checkout day.
* Wi-Fi Gateway Connectivity: Pair your lock with a G2 Wi-Fi gateway. This enables real-time notifications on your phone, showing you exactly when the guest enters or exits, and alerts you when the lock's battery drops below 20%.

Maintaining Guest Privacy and Building Security

Unlike standalone houses, Westlands apartments are subject to estate management rules. You must coordinate with the building’s management committee (often managed by a resident association) to register your smart lock and understand access protocols.
* Exterior Security: Install a smart video doorbell (like Ring or Eufy) pointing at the corridor. This allows you to verify how many guests are entering your apartment, protecting you against occupancy fraud (e.g., a guest booking for two but bringing in ten).
* Noise Monitoring: Westlands is known for its nightlife, but your apartment building will have strict quiet-hour rules. Install a Minut Noise Monitor. This device measures decibel levels without recording audio, alerting you automatically if a party is occurring, allowing you to message the guest before neighbors complain.


2. Managing Utilities and Connectivity Remotely

In a premium business hub like Westlands, internet outages or utility disruptions will instantly result in poor reviews and booking cancellations. You need to automate your billing and monitoring processes.

High-Speed Internet Setup

Business travelers require flawless, high-speed internet. Install a reliable fiber connection with a reputable local ISP, such as Safaricom Home Fibre (minimum 40 Mbps package) or Zuku Fiber. Set up your monthly subscription payments on auto-pay via your M-Pesa Till number or international credit card linked to the provider’s digital portal. Always have a backup mobile data router (such as a Telkom or Airtel MiFi) pre-loaded with data packages so your housekeeper can set it up if the main fiber link goes offline.

KPLC Electricity and Prepaid Meters

Most modern Westlands apartments utilize KPLC prepaid meters. Monitor the unit balance remotely by using the MyPower app or by having your cleaner text you the token balance during turns. Set a recurring calendar reminder to purchase prepaid tokens via M-Pesa Paybill (888880). Maintain a buffer of at least 150 units at all times to prevent sudden power disconnections mid-stay.

Water and Backups

While Westlands generally has reliable municipal water, water shortages can occur in Nairobi. Ensure your building has an active borehole and massive underground water storage tanks. Confirm that your unit's internal booster pump is working correctly and that the automatic float switch is operational so the header tank fills up automatically without human intervention.


3. Assembling Your Westlands Operations Team

A remote business is only as strong as its local team. To successfully manage airbnb from diaspora, you must recruit, train, and compensate a reliable local squad.

The Three Pillars of Your Ground Team

  1. The Cleaning and Turnaround Specialist: This person does more than sweep; they are your quality control inspector. They check for property damage, wash linens, restock toiletries (local Kenyan brands like Leleshwa or Cinnabar Green are highly rated by guests), and ensure the welcome basket is full.
  2. The Emergency Technician: Have a certified Nairobi electrician and plumber on call. Instant water heaters (commonly used in Nairobi apartments) frequently burn out or trip circuit breakers; having a technician who can replace a heating element within two hours is invaluable.

4. Legal Compliance and Financial Architecture

Operating a short-term rental in Nairobi requires compliance with national and county regulations. Failing to register your business can lead to massive fines or closure by authorities.

Regulatory and Tax Checklist

  • KRA Monthly Rental Income (MRI) Tax: You are legally required to pay tax on residential rental income. Under current KRA guidelines, MRI is charged at a flat rate of 7.5% of the gross monthly rent collected. You must file and pay this through the iTax portal by the 20th of the following month.
  • Tourism Fund Levy: As a commercial short-term rental, you must register with the Tourism Regulatory Authority (TRA) and pay the 2% monthly Tourism Fund Levy.
  • Nairobi County Single Business Permit: You must acquire a business permit from the Nairobi City County government to operate legally.
  • Property Search via Ardhisasa: When purchasing your Westlands apartment, ensure the sectional title deed is verified and cleared through the Ministry of Lands' digital portal, Ardhisasa, to guarantee clean, unencumbered ownership.

6. The Ultimate Westlands Diaspora Host Checklist

Ensure all these items are in place before welcoming your first international or corporate guest:

  • [ ] Smart Lock Installed: Weather-resistant with temporary PIN generation capacity.
  • [ ] Dual-Band Wi-Fi Router: Placed in a central location, with guest network access enabled.
  • [ ] Back-up Power Unit: An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) for the router and a small inverter for lighting during Nairobi blackouts.
  • [ ] Minut Decibel Monitor: Installed in the living area to monitor noise levels.
  • [ ] Smart CCTV at the Door: Wired to the apartment exterior hallway to monitor check-ins.
  • [ ] Digital Welcome Guidebook: Formatted as a PDF/link detailing smart lock use, Wi-Fi details, Sarit Centre dining spots, and local taxi contacts.
  • [ ] Dedicated M-Pesa Till Number: Setup via Safaricom for seamless, trackable business transactions.
  • [ ] Registered with KRA & TRA: Fully compliant with Kenyan tax and tourism regulations.
